Primary Exploration of Hydrogen Metallurgy / by Jianliang Zhang, Kejiang Li, Zhengjian Liu, Tianjun Yang
Introduction -- Preparation and storage of hydrogen -- Hydrogen direct reduction of iron oxides -- Hydrogen Melt Reduction of Iron Oxides -- Plasma hydrogen reduction of iron oxides -- Hydrogen Behavior in Sintering Processes -- Future Outlook..
This book is a monograph dedicated to hydrogen metallurgy technology in iron ore reduction in the world (mainly in China), aiming to accelerate the development of hydrogen metallurgy research and promote the low-carbon process in the iron and steel industry. This book mainly introduces the frontier theory and process technology of hydrogen metallurgy, focusing on the behavior and role of hydrogen in reducing iron ore. The specific contents include hydrogen production and storage technology, hydrogen direct reduction of iron oxide technology, hydrogen smelting reduction of iron oxide technology, plasma hydrogen reduction of iron oxide theory, and the behavior of hydrogen in blast furnace iron-making and sintering processes. This book provides a comprehensive and detailed description of the theories and process technologies involved in hydrogen metallurgy at the levels of fundamental theory, feasibility analysis, experimental studies, and industrial applications. This book can be used as a reference for metallurgical engineering, iron, and steel metallurgy majors, as well as teachers and students, researchers, engineers, and enterprise staff interested in hydrogen and low-carbon metallurgy-related fields..
